Safer Chhoti Population - Nagaur, Rajasthan

Safer Chhoti is a medium size village located in Makrana Tehsil of Nagaur district, Rajasthan with total 188 families residing. The Safer Chhoti village has population of 1060 of which 560 are males while 500 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Safer Chhoti village population of children with age 0-6 is 168 which makes up 15.85 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Safer Chhoti village is 893 which is lower than Rajasthan state average of 928. Child Sex Ratio for the Safer Chhoti as per census is 826, lower than Rajasthan average of 888.

Safer Chhoti village has lower literacy rate compared to Rajasthan. In 2011, literacy rate of Safer Chhoti village was 65.02 % compared to 66.11 % of Rajasthan. In Safer Chhoti Male literacy stands at 75.85 % while female literacy rate was 53.07 %.

As per constitution of India and Panchyati Raaj Act, Safer Chhoti village is administrated by Sarpanch (Head of Village) who is elected representative of village. Our website, don't have information about schools and hospital in Safer Chhoti village.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 10.75 % of total population in Safer Chhoti village. The village Safer Chhoti curr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Safer Chhoti village out of total population, 329 were engaged in work activities. 36.78 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 63.22 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 329 workers engaged in Main Work, 25 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 5 were Agricultural labourer.
